The Folin phenol reagent, also referred to as Folin-Ciocalteu reagent, plays a significant duty in the quantification of healthy proteins. This reagent is made use of in the Folin phenol method, a colorimetric assay for figuring out the protein focus in biological examples. The approach entails the decrease of the Folin phenol reagent by tyrosine and tryptophan deposits in proteins, causing a blue color that can be determined spectrophotometrically. This assay is widely used in biochemistry and molecular biology for healthy protein quantification, providing accurate and trusted outcomes that are important for different research study applications.
